body{margin:0; font:Verdana, Arial, Helvetica, sans-serif; font-size:12px; background:#c6c6c6;}
ul,li{margin:0; padding:0; list-style:none;}
a:link{text-decoration:none; color:#000000;}
a:visited{text-decoration:none; color:#000000;}
a:hover{text-decoration:none; color:#067A9B;}
a:active{text-decoration:none; color:#191919;}
.wrap{width:1003px; height:1000px;}
.left{width:216px; height:1000px; float:left; background:url(left.jpg) no-repeat;}
.center{width:787px; height:1000px; float:left; }
.header{width:787px; height:134px; float:left; background:url(top.jpg) no-repeat; }
.menu{margin:40px 0 0 44px;}
.submenu{width:600px; height:25px; color:#FFFFFF; line-height:25px; margin:31px 0 0 0; text-align:right;}
.topnews{width:787px; height:202px; float:left; background:url(news.jpg) no-repeat; }
.newspic{width:208px; height:150px; float:left; margin:20px 0 0 5px;}
.newslist{width:400px; height:140px; margin:20px 0 0 10px;float:left; padding:30px 0 0 0; line-height:20px;}
span{color:#999999; font-size:11px;}
.middle{width:787px; height:189px;float:left;}
.fication{width:349px; height:129px; float:left; background:url(fiction.jpg) no-repeat; line-height:20px; padding:60px 0 0 0;}
.blog{width:438px; height:119px; float:left; background:url(blog.jpg) no-repeat; line-height:20px; padding:70px 0 0 0;}
.video{width:757px; height:125px;background:url(video.jpg) no-repeat; padding:0 0 0 30px;float:left;}
.bottom{width:787px; height:50px;background:url(bottom.jpg) no-repeat;float:left; padding:300px 0 0 0; line-height:50px;}
.video li{width:126px; height:115px; margin:0 8px 0 0; float:left; text-align:center; line-height:20px; overflow:hidden;}
